Voltage test didn't change with all 4 tubes removed, so I went on to this. The meter stopped at almost exactly 6.8 K Ohms.
Well, 6.8K is reasonable enough, considering that the B+ bleeder string to ground (R127A and R128A) add up to 8.1K. Current will only be around 45 ma., nowhere near the 175 or so ma. that's going thru poor R127B.

It almost looks like a B+ filter cap is breaking down under voltage, like maybe a cap has been replaced with one having too low a voltage rating. The most likely suspect would be C4A, which should be 40 mf and rated at 450V. Does the C4 can show evidence of heating?
